Robert W. Tegeder, Sr., our devoted father, grandfather and great-grandfather, passed away of natural causes on May 27, 2012, at the age of 88.
He was born on September 12, 1923 in the farming community of Meredosia, Illinois to Dorthea Roegge and John Tegeder. He was the youngest of four children and the only one to leave the farm to pursue a college education. In 1949, he graduated from Concordia Teacher''s College in River Forest, Illinois and went on to get a master''s degree from Wayne State University in Detroit. He was a teacher at the Lutheran School for the Deaf in Detroit from 1950-1957.
Robert and his family then moved to Ogden, Utah where he served as a Principal at the Utah Schools for the Deaf and Blind from 1957 to 1959 and Superintendent from 1960 to 1978. He continued to work for Utah''s Department of Public Education as a Consulting Specialist for the Hearing Impaired until he retired in 1987. He and his wife settled in Clearfield, Utah.
In 1950, Robert married his childhood sweetheart, E. Bernice Korsmeyer (who passed away in 2009). He was a big sports fan and if the St. Louis Cardinals were playing baseball, he was watching, as he was a lifelong fan. He was also a big supporter of Weber State athletics and the Utah Jazz.
Robert was a lifelong member of the Lutheran Church, Missouri Synod, and was an active member of St. Paul Lutheran Church in Ogden, for 50+ years.
He was preceded in death by his wife, and siblings. He is survived by his 4 children, Robert Tegeder, Jr. (Wendy), of Renton, Washington; Marjorie Tegeder of Clearfield; Jane Cameron (Randy) of Salt Lake City; and Alice Peterson (Randy) of Boise, Idaho; 9 grandchildren and 7 great-grandchildren.
